The solicitation seeks two portable body composition analyzers capable of delivering non-invasive, accurate measurements including body fat mass, percent bodyfat, weight, muscle mass, body mass index, total body water, dry lean muscle, skeletal muscle mass, and basal metabolic rate. The device must be auto-calibrated, user-friendly, and operate within a weight range of 225 to 551 pounds, an age range of 3 to 99 years, and a height range of 3 feet 1.4 inches to 7 feet 2.6 inches. It must carry a one-year warranty and comply with FDA regulations under Class II device regulation 870.2770, requiring 510(k) clearance, registration, listing, proper labeling, and adherence to GMP standards. Technical and quality requirements are governed by the DLA Master List of Technical and Quality Requirements, and the item must be marked in accordance with the Medical Marking Standard No. 1, superseding MIL-STD-129. Packaging must be commercial, sealed for protection, and palletized per RP001, with all shipping containers conforming to MIL-STD-2073-1E. Hazardous materials, if any, must be labeled per 29 CFR 1910.1200 and supported by an SDS submitted prior to award. The equipment is subject to the Buy American Act and Berry Amendment, with a reduced threshold of $150,000, and must not include covered telecommunications equipment. The procurement is a Small Business Set-Aside, and offerors must validate their SAM representations, including size status and HUBZone eligibility, with the government using HUBZone price evaluation preference. Delivery is required within 20 days of order placement to Fort Bragg, North Carolina, under FOB Destination terms, with destination inspection mandatory per FAR 52.246-2. Electronic invoicing via WAWF is required, and contractors must register with DLA’s AMPS system to access the Vendor Shipment Module. The solicitation incorporates the DLA Master Solicitation Revision 105, includes numerous FAR and DFARS clauses covering cybersecurity, trafficking, employment eligibility, sustainability, and DoD-specific compliance, with multiple deviations applied for streamlined processes.
